Submitted by tsimien on 02/11/2010 - 20:28 FABLAB@SCHOOL is installed and functioning at Lyceum 1502 in Moscow, Russia. The FABLAB@SCHOOL is a partnership between D. Euan Baird, SEED, Schlumberger, and Stanford University, in collaboration with the Center for Bits and Atoms at MIT. Inspired by MIT’s FabLab concept, Stanford University Professor Paulo Blikstein created the FabLab@School, a brand-new kind of educational space to learn science, mathematics, and engineering, using cutting-edge fabrication and prototyping equipment, robotics, scientific instrumentation, and computer modeling. The first FABLAB@SCHOOL workshop was held at Lyceum 1502 in Moscow, Russia April 25-29, 2011. The official inauguration was on June 9, 2011. Read more about this project in its Discussion Forum.
